Feb. 21, 2010
George Mason's men's tennis team lost 5-2 to Christopher Newport at the indoor courts at Monclair Country Club on Saturday. CNU swept all three doubles matches to earn the point and won four of the singles matches as they drop the Patriots to 2-3 in the spring dual match season.
Four of the six singles matches were extended past two sets with the Patriots claiming wins in the top two singles spots. Sophomore Jorge Osuna won his match by taking the first set then winning the tie-breaker set 7-6(7-4). Freshman Kevin McMillen won the Patriots second point from the No. 2 position in three sets as well, 6-4, 3-6, 6-2.
The Patriots are back in action next Saturday against Richmond.
